Product Features

Sintered stainless steel mesh is a new type of filter material made of multi-layer metal woven wire mesh through special lamination pressing and vacuum sintering processes. The meshes of each layer of mesh are interlaced to form a uniform and ideal filter material. The filter structure has excellent filtration accuracy, filtration resistance, mechanical strength, wear resistance, heat resistance, cold resistance, and processability, and is ideal for filtration that requires high compressive strength and uniform filtration accuracy.

Performance advantages:

1. High strength and good rigidity: it has extremely high mechanical strength and compressive strength;

2. High precision, uniform, and stable: the filter particle size with a nominal precision of 1~300μm can achieve a uniform and consistent filtration performance, and the mesh does not change during use;

3. Wide range of use environments: it can be used for filtration in temperature environments from -200°C to 650°C and in acid-base corrosion environments;

4. Excellent cleaning performance: good countercurrent cleaning effect, can be used repeatedly, and has a long service life (can be cleaned by countercurrent water, filtrate, ultrasonic, dissolving, baking, etc.).

Product structure

The standard five-layer mesh is composed of a protection layer, a precision control layer, dispersion layer, two strengthening layers.

1. Protection layer

On the control layer for protection and protection in the process of maintaining stability in micro-pore shape and size.

2. Control layer

Precise wire mesh as a key work of the sintered filter materials, sintered wire mesh filtration accuracy by its control.

3. Dispersion layer

Filter media by sintered mesh control, guide to the filter media stream and keep control of micro-hole shape and dimensional stability.

4. Strengthening layer

Wire diameter coarse pores larger wire for support, to improve overall strength and stiffness of the sintered wire mesh.

Production Process

Standard 5-layer stainless steel sintered wire mesh, first of all, each layer is woven according to a specific weaving method, and then each layer is put together to apply pressure and superimpose according to a certain process, followed by high-temperature vacuum sintering, and then different pores will be formed According to the needs of customers, different sizes and edge treatments are customized, and the edge is generally welded.
